Made: 8th March 2016

Laid before Parliament: 10th March 2016

Coming into force: 1st April 2016

The Secretary of State for Education makes the following Regulations in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 87D(2) and 104(4)(a) of the Children Act 1989[^f00001], sections 12(2), 15(3), 16(3) and 118(5), (6) and (7) of the Care Standards Act 2000[^f00002] and sections 155(1) and (2) and 181(2)(a) and (b) of the Education and Inspections Act 2006[^f00003].

SCHEDULE — SUBSTITUTION OF FEES PAYABLE UNDER THE PRINCIPAL REGULATIONS

Provision of the principal Regulations (1) Old fee (2) New fee (3)
Regulation 4 (registration fees: voluntary adoption agencies)
paragraph (1)(a) £1670 £1837
paragraph (1)(b)(i) £1670 £1837
paragraph (1)(b)(ii) £455 £501
paragraph (2)(a) £455 £501
paragraph (2)(b)(i) £1670 £1837
paragraph (2)(b)(ii) £455 £501
Regulation 5 (registration fees: adoption support agencies)
paragraph (1) £1670 £1837
paragraph (2) £455 £501
paragraph (3) £455 £501
Regulation 6 (registration fees: children’s homes)
paragraph (1) £2405 £2646
paragraph (2) £656 £722
paragraph (3) £656 £722
Regulation 7 (registration fees: residential family centres)
paragraph (1) £2004 £2204
paragraph (2) £547 £602
paragraph (3) £547 £602
Regulation 8 (registration fees: fostering agencies)
paragraph (1) £2405 £2646
paragraph (2) £656 £722
Regulation 12 (variation fees: voluntary adoption agencies)
paragraph (1)(a) £835 £919
paragraph (1)(b) £455 £501
paragraph (2)(a) £835 £919
paragraph (2)(b) £455 £501
paragraph (3) £76 £84
Regulation 13 (variation fees: adoption support agencies)
paragraph (1) £835 £919
paragraph (2) £455 £501
paragraph (3) £76 £84
Regulation 14 (variation fees: children’s homes)
paragraph (1) £1202 £1322
paragraph (2) £656 £722
paragraph (3) £109 £120
Regulation 15 (variation fees: residential family centres)
paragraph (1) £1002 £1102
paragraph (2) £547 £602
paragraph (3) £91 £100
Regulation 16 (variation fees: fostering agencies)
paragraph (1) £1202 £1322
paragraph (2) £109 £120
Regulation 19 (annual fees: boarding schools, residential colleges and residential special schools)
paragraph (1)(a) £765 £842
paragraph (1)(b)(i) £765 £842
paragraph (1)(b)(ii) £46 £51
paragraph (1)(c) £1203 £1323
paragraph (1)(d) £1683 £1851
paragraph (1)(e) £2021 £2223
paragraph (2)(a) £765 £842
paragraph (2)(b)(i) £765 £842
paragraph (2)(b)(ii) £46 £51
paragraph (2)(c) £1173 £1290
paragraph (3)(a) £1408 £1549
paragraph (3)(b)(i) £1408 £1549
paragraph (3)(b)(ii) £140 £154
paragraph (3)(c) £3508 £3859
Regulation 20 (annual fees: voluntary adoption agencies)
paragraph (1)(a) £1153 £1268
paragraph (1)(b)(i) £1153 £1268
paragraph (1)(b)(ii) £612 £673
paragraph (2)(a) £612 £673
paragraph (2)(b)(i) £1153 £1268
paragraph (2)(b)(ii) £612 £673
Regulation 21 (annual fees: adoption support agencies)
paragraph (1) £1157 £1273
paragraph (2) £612 £673
Regulation 22 (annual fees: fostering agencies)
paragraph (1) £1933 £2126
Regulation 23 (annual fees: children’s homes)
paragraph (1)(a) £1761 £1937
paragraph (1)(b)(i) £1761 £1937
paragraph (1)(b)(ii) £176 £194
paragraph (1)(c) £7039 £7526
Regulation 24 (annual fees: residential family centres)
paragraph (1)(a) £1173 £1290
paragraph (1)(b) £1320 £1452
paragraph (1)(c) £1377 £1515
Regulation 26 (annual fees: local authority adoption and fostering functions)
paragraph (1)(a) £1406 £1547
paragraph (1)(b) £2197 £2417

EXPLANATORY NOTE

These Regulations apply to England only.

Regulation 2 and the Schedule increase certain fees payable under Parts 2, 3 and 4 of the Her Majesty’s Chief Inspector of Education, Children’s Services and Skills (Fees and Frequency of Inspections)(Children’s Homes etc.) Regulations 2015 (S.I.2015/551) (“the principal Regulations”).

In particular, they increase the fees that are payable to the Chief Inspector in respect of—

They also increase the annual fees payable by the above establishments and agencies as well as those payable by boarding schools, residential colleges, residential special schools and in respect of local authority adoption and fostering functions.

Regulation 3 revokes regulations 10 and 17 of the principal Regulations.

An Impact Assessment has not been produced for this instrument as it has minimal impact on business or civil society organisations.
